- Retreat of Serson Ice Shelf
- 09.11.08
-- As recently as the early 1900s, the northern coast of Canada's Ellesmere Island was fringed by a continuous expanse of ice. By July 2008, warming Arctic climate had reduced the continuous ice to five isolated shelves. In July and Aguust three of the shelves experienced further significant retreat.

- Both Routes Around Arctic Open at Summer's End
- 09.09.08
-- As of the first week of September 2008, Arctic sea ice extent had not fallen below 2007's record low, but for the first time since satellite observations began three decades ago, sea ice retreated enough to create open waters all the way around the northern ice pack.

- Wintertime Disinteghration of Wilkins Ice Shelf
- 07.19.08
-- On the Antarctic Peninsula, the Wilkins Ice Shelf historically extended toward Charcot Island in the northwest, and Latady Island in the southwest. By July 2008, the ice shelf's connection to Charcot Island, which had helped to hold the shelf in place, was nearly gone.

- Arctic Sea Ice Distribution by Age
- 03.18.08
-- The sea ice in the Arctic is much younger than normal, with vast regions now covered by first-year ice. The left image shows February distribution of ice by its age during normal Arctic conditions (1985-2000 average), and the right illustrates February 2008 Arctic ice age distribution.
